The polynomial y=−0.73x4+3.1x3+26.5 describes the billions of flu virus particles in a person's body x days after being infected. Find the number of virus particles, in billions, after 3 days. There are billion virus particles in a person's body 3 days after being infected.

Answer:

51.07 billion virus particles

Step-by-step explanation:

The equation that describes the number, in billions, of flu virus particles in a person's body x days after being infected is:

[tex]y=-0.73x^4+3.1x^3+26.5[/tex]

For x = 3 days:

[tex]y(3)=-0.73*3^4+3.1*3^3+26.5\\y(3) = 51.07\ billion[/tex]

Therefore, after 3 days, there will be 51.07 billion virus particles in a person's body.
